DESCRIPTION:Green Open Homes Chippenham is an opportunity to ask a Chippenham home owner about an energy saving improvement they’ve made\, and see if it might work for you. \nPeople who have made energy saving improvements open up their homes for free in-person visits to share their experiences. Visiting a home is a great way to find out about the reality of getting solar panels\, insulation\, triple glazing\, or a heat pump without talking to a salesman. \nYou can have a good look at the technology\, ask the home owner how easy or difficult their improvements were\, and find out how much they’re really saving on their energy bills as a result.

DESCRIPTION:The English Civil War returns to Chippenham as the Town plays host to the English Civil War Society and the town is returned to the dramatic Summer of 1643 when the Civil War raged across Wiltshire and the West Country. \nEach afternoon there will be intense conflict as the Royalist and Roundhead Armies clash in Battle on Monkton Park with over 400 Pikemen\, Musketeers\, Gunners\, and Cavalry all taking part. This event\, inspired by a dramatic moment in Chippenham’s history will prove to be a massive weekend of Entertainment\, Excitement and Education by the English Civil War Society. \nAs in 1643\, Chippenham Village will also be occupied by Royalist soldiers from Sir Ralph Hopton’s army marching from the hard-fought battle at Lansdown Hill near Bath. Soldiers and Officers will be working at their Military Encampment while expecting a visit from their General Sir Ralph. A Regiment of Foote\, Cavalry on Horseback\, and Cannon will be taking part in further displays through the day for Visitors to see on Monkton Park. \nThere will be a large and thriving encampment and tented village on The Island\, Monkton Park\, where 17th Century trades and crafts will be demonstrated by the townsfolk and including a working printing press giving out the latest newssheets with tidings of the war and other news. Here the re-enactors will be happy to meet visitors\, explain their work and to share stories about Chippenham’s role in the English Civil War. \nCheck out the full timetable giving details of all the Displays through each day: –

DESCRIPTION:The Arc Jam is a chance to celebrate the official opening of The Arc\, a brand-new climbing centre\, skatepark and cafe facility in Chippenham. \nThe Arc Jam will include: – \n\ndemonstrations by professional skateboarders\nskatepark competitions with prizes\nphotos and video opportunities on the day to show off your skills in the bowl\nclimbing demonstrations on the outside wall\n\nCanvas \nThe skatepark was designed and built by Bristol Skatepark design specialists\, CANVAS\, who will be hosting the range of activities around the skatepark on the 9th. The skatepark competitions will be split up into different categories depending on those in attendance on the day. These will be carried out in an ‘informal jam format’ to ensure that the day is inclusive to all ages and abilities. Prizes awarded to those e.g. who are doing impressive tricks\, having the most fun\, showing the most progression etc. \nClimbing demonstrations \nThere will also be climbing demonstrations from a wide range of climbers on the outside wall from 12-3pm but the climbing centre and café will be open as normal. \nEverest climber – Kenton Cool \nLegendary British climber\, Kenton Cool\, will also be attending the launch event. In May this year he is attempting to summit Everest for a record-breaking 16th attempt. He was the first man to climb Nuptse\, Everest and Lhotse in a climbing season.  A great opportunity to see and meet one of Britain’s most high-profile and celebrated climbers. \n\nThe Arc was built by Chippenham Borough Lands Charity (CBLC) and is being run by The Climbing Academy (TCA). This brand new purpose-built centre offers bouldering\, roped climbing\, a cafe and the free skatepark overlooking Westmead playing field. \nThe Arc \nThe Arc is a safe and supportive space for families\, individuals and youth or community groups. You can start bouldering anytime without doing a course\, but the centre offers taster sessions and beginners roped courses for newcomers\, as well as skills coaching. \nAn accessible sport \nClimbing is a welcoming sport that is accessible to all shapes\, sizes and ages. You can boulder from any age and over 70s climb for free at all TCA centres. The centre is fully accessible with free on-site parking for disabled customers. The sport\, which featured in the recent summer Olympics for the first time\, has proven benefits to both physical and mental health. Providing active movement\, from energetic overhangs at height to balanced slab traverses only centimetres off a mat. It helps participants to improve confidence and focus. \nThe Climbing Academy \nTCA opened its first centre in Bristol in 2008. The Arc is TCA’s 3rd centre in the south west of England and 5th centre in total\, with 2 in Glasgow. \nChippenham Borough Lands Charity \nChippenham Borough Lands Charity is a grant giving organisation that supports local residents in welfare\, education\, arts and community projects.
